Abstract

In article number 1802607, Ning Wang, Xiaolin Wang, Hui Wu and co‐workers present a new strategy based on pre‐amidoximation and blow spinning technique for industry scale production of fully amidoximated poly(imide dioxime) nanofiber adsorbent with significantly enhanced capacity and practicability for uranium extraction from natural seawater. The outstanding performance is attributed to the full coverage of chelating sites, excellent hydrophilicity, 3D porous architecture and good mechanical properties. [ABSTRACT FROM AUTHOR]
